    She sounds lovely, obviously someone abandoned her if she is already spayed.

    I don't understand why they don't allow her to live outside. Obviously, she is at greater risk for infections, etc., but she's going to have her life cut even more abruptly short if she goes to the shelter, and the people who are allergic could keep an eye on her outside. It takes a significant bite for FIV transmission to take place and if she's not challenged on her territory, and she not going to take part in mating any more, then she won't pass it on.
